使用Vue和OpenLayers绘制自定义图形并导出为GeoJSON文件
在本文中,我们将探讨如何使用Vue和OpenLayers框架来绘制自定义图形,并将其导出为GeoJSON文件。GeoJSON是一种开放的地理数据格式,常用于存储和交换地理空间信息。通过结合Vue框架和OpenLayers库,我们可以在Web应用程序中轻松实现这一功能。
首先,确保你已经安装了Vue和OpenLayers的依赖项。我们可以使用Vue CLI来快速创建一个基本的Vue应用程序。打开终端并运行以下命令:
vue create my-app
cd my-app
然后,选择你喜欢的preset配置,等待项目创建完成后,进入项目目录。
接下来,安装OpenLayers库。运行以下命令:
npm install ol
安装完成后,我们可以开始编写代码。
首先,在Vue组件中引入OpenLayers库:
import {
本文介绍了如何使用Vue和OpenLayers框架绘制自定义图形,并将其导出为GeoJSON文件。首先,确保安装Vue和OpenLayers依赖,然后在Vue组件中引入OpenLayers,创建地图容器。接着,编写绘制图形的方法,监听绘制完成事件,将几何图形转换为GeoJSON字符串。最后,使用文件保存库将GeoJSON保存为文件。
订阅专栏 解锁全文
6865

被折叠的 条评论
为什么被折叠?



